I have been doing this for years. One thing that stands out is the poor communications between the parties especially when they don't agree. Instead of upping the communications, problem solving and expanding on the different points of view, a total breakdown occurs. Then, many make it worse. Its like falling into a 3 foot hole and panicking making it into a 6 foot hole. More work to get out of!

Another thing that stands out is how everything is blown out of proportion which leads to additional problems and finally a mess that has to be arbitrated, decided upon or even assessed for disciplinary action. Its like hydration in a human being. You are supposed to drink before you are thirsty. When you thirst, it is too late. Same with behavior that leads to trouble. Check it before it goes any farther
PROBLEM then SOLUTION
Deal with issues that come up while they are tiny and handle-able and they wont reach epic proportions that require drastic attentions.
